来源:677手游网 更新:2024-02-04 09:09:21
用手机看
存储过程是Oracle数据库中非常重要的一种对象,它可以将一系列的SQL语句封装起来,并通过简单的调用来实现复杂的业务逻辑。在我多年的数据库开发和维护经验中,我积累了一些关于Oracle存储过程的创建和使用的经验,现在我将这些经验与大家分享。
1.存储过程的创建
在创建存储过程时,我们需要考虑以下几个方面:
-命名规范:为了方便管理和维护,建议给存储过程起一个有意义的名字,并使用统一的命名规范,比如以“SP_”开头。
-输入参数:根据实际需求,确定存储过程是否需要输入参数。如果需要,要定义参数名称、类型和长度等信息,并且在编写SQL语句时使用这些参数。
-输出参数:如果存储过程需要返回结果,则可以定义输出参数,并在存储过程中将结果赋值给这些参数。
-异常处理:为了保证程序的健壮性,在存储过程中应该考虑异常处理机制,比如使用异常块来捕获并处理异常情况。
2.存储过程的使用
一旦存储过程创建完成,我们可以通过以下方式来使用它:
-调用存储过程:使用“CALL”或者“EXECUTE”语句来调用存储过程,并传入相应的参数。在调用存储过程时,可以使用变量来接收返回结果。
telegeram官方最新版:https://www.mootshanghai.org/danji/17841.html